Indian troops resort to unprovoked firing at Charwa sector

SIALKOT (92 News) – The Indian Border Security Force resorted to sporadic unprovoked firing at Charwa sector of the Working Boundary in Sialkot.
According to senior officials of the Chenab Rangers, the Indian forces started firing and mortar shelling on Pakistani villages, which continued after intervals.
The Chenab Rangers gave a forceful response befittingly, silencing the Indian guns.
